IContributedButton interface
Define um botão a partir de uma contribuição de primeira ou de terceiros
Propriedades
| command | O id de uma contribuição de comando a ser executada quando o botão é clicado |
| command |
Rugments opcionais para passar ao invocar o comando fornecido |
| contribution |
ID da contribuição em que o botão foi definido (opcional, usado para resolver URLs de ícones relativos) |
| disabled | Se verdadeiro, o botão não pode ser interagido. |
| href | Href para navegar quando o botão é clicado. Passe se este for um botão de link. |
| icon | Um url (relativo ou totalmente qualificado) ou um IContributedIconDefinition com urls para temas claros e escuros. Isso permite que o chamador use diferentes estilos de ícones com base no tipo de tema. |
| primary | Defina como true se este botão deve ser estilizado com uma cor primária. |
| target | Opcional, contexto no qual o recurso vinculado será aberto. |
| text | Texto para renderizar dentro do botão. |
| tooltip | Valor opcional para usar como rótulo de ária e dica de ferramenta para o botão. |
Detalhes de Propriedade
command
O id de uma contribuição de comando a ser executada quando o botão é clicado
command?: string
Valor de Propriedade
string
commandArguments
Rugments opcionais para passar ao invocar o comando fornecido
commandArguments?: any[]
Valor de Propriedade
any[]
contributionId
ID da contribuição em que o botão foi definido (opcional, usado para resolver URLs de ícones relativos)
contributionId?: string
Valor de Propriedade
string
disabled
Se verdadeiro, o botão não pode ser interagido.
disabled?: boolean
Valor de Propriedade
boolean
href
Href para navegar quando o botão é clicado. Passe se este for um botão de link.
href?: string
Valor de Propriedade
string
icon
Um url (relativo ou totalmente qualificado) ou um IContributedIconDefinition com urls para temas claros e escuros. Isso permite que o chamador use diferentes estilos de ícones com base no tipo de tema.
icon?: string | IContributedIconDefinition
Valor de Propriedade
string | IContributedIconDefinition
primary
Defina como true se este botão deve ser estilizado com uma cor primária.
primary?: boolean
Valor de Propriedade
boolean
target
Opcional, contexto no qual o recurso vinculado será aberto.
target?: string
Valor de Propriedade
string
text
Texto para renderizar dentro do botão.
text?: string
Valor de Propriedade
string
tooltip
Valor opcional para usar como rótulo de ária e dica de ferramenta para o botão.
tooltip?: string
Valor de Propriedade
string